Answer:

c = 3
√(6)

Explanation:

triangle is right isosceles so both sides equal 3
√(3)

can use pythagorean theorem which is square each leg and set it equal to the hypotenuse (side 'c') squared

(3
√(3))^2 + (3
√(3))^2 = c^2

(9x3) + (9x3) = c^2

27 + 27 = c^2

54 = c^2

c =
√(54)

simplify
√(54) to equal =
√(9) x
√(6) which simplies to 3
√(6)
